The variety belongs to the early-maturing group. The fruits have an elongated conical shape, resembling a "goat horn," with a smooth surface. At the stage of technical maturity, the fruit color is yellow-green, turning red upon ripening. The flesh has a pronounced aroma and a pungent, spicy taste.
The plant is suitable for accelerated cultivation under plastic covers, in greenhouses, as well as in the open field in regions with a warm climate. The variety shows resistance to tobacco mosaic virus.
